A $62,000 salary in Nevada gives you an estimated take-home pay of about $54,177 per year ($4,515 per month) after federal income tax and FICA (Nevada has no state income tax) in 2026, an effective tax rate of 12.6%. Figures shown are for the married filing jointly filing status.

Breakdown of $62,000 in Nevada (2026)

Gross salary$62,000
Standard deduction tax-free $32,200
Federal income tax โˆ’$3,080
Social Security (6.2%) โˆ’$3,844
Medicare (1.45%) โˆ’$899
Nevada state income tax none $0
Total taxโˆ’$7,823
Take-home pay$54,177
